Problema com uma pesquisa SQL que compara Datas! URGENTE

Delphi

01/03/2004

Olá,
Estou tentando fazer uma query (SQL) em que o resultado sai da seguinte condiçao:
´WHERE locacao.DT_HORA_PREVISTA_RETORNO < ´ + Datetostr(dataagora);

porem essa condiçao esta dando um erro q diz que o tipo esperava number e obteve date. No banco esse campo DT_HORA_RETIRADA é do tipo DATE e está guardando uma data.
Se alguem pudesse ajudar seria otimo!
vlw


Pedro Telles

Pedro Telles

Curtidas 0

Respostas

Skaarj

Skaarj

01/03/2004

´WHERE locacao.DT_HORA_PREVISTA_RETORNO < :dAgora´
Query1.parambyname(´dAgora´).asDateTime := date;

Tenta assim, com parametros..


GOSTEI 0
Pedro Telles

Pedro Telles

01/03/2004

Excelente ideia!
Funciono perfeitamente.
Mt Obrigado
:D


GOSTEI 0
POSTAR